What Service Page Architecture For Biotech Manufacturing Means

Direct Answer: Service Page Architecture For Biotech Manufacturing means designing each commercial page around one clear service, capability, or solution family so buyers and search systems can understand what the page offers, what production or quality issues it addresses, who it fits, how it works, and what next step should happen.

Many biotech websites still group too much into one generic services page. That may feel efficient internally, yet it usually weakens performance. A page that tries to rank for biotech contract manufacturing, sterile packaging solutions, cleanroom assembly, validation support, custom biotech production support, and single-use component manufacturing at the same time often becomes too broad for both buyers and search engines.

Strong service page architecture solves that problem by giving each major offer its own page and its own role. Therefore, Biotech Contract Manufacturing should usually have its own page. Sterile Packaging Solutions should usually have its own page. Validation Support Services should usually have its own page. Each page can then speak directly to the buyer intent, technical fit, process, trust signals, and internal links that matter for that capability.

In other words, architecture is not just layout. Instead, it is page purpose. It defines what each service page targets, what questions it answers, what objections it reduces, what conversions it supports, and how it connects to the rest of the site.

Core Service Page Structure For Biotech Manufacturing

Direct Answer: The best biotech manufacturing service pages follow a structure that moves from immediate clarity to solution explanation, fit, trust, process, and conversion without letting the buyer lose context.

Recommended Service Page Sections

  • Short eyebrow or kicker
  • H1 with the exact service name or best keyword match
  • Top summary snippet
  • 2 to 4 supporting intro paragraphs
  • What the service is
  • Problems the service solves
  • Who the service fits
  • Industry, application, or quality relevance
  • How the process works
  • Proof, experience, or trust signals
  • FAQ section
  • Related solutions and support-content links
  • Conversion section with practical next steps

Why This Structure Works

This structure works because it matches how biotech buyers evaluate. First, they need clarity. Next, they need relevance. Then, they need confidence. Finally, they need a practical path toward the next conversation. Therefore, the page should move in that order instead of jumping randomly between big claims and contact prompts.

How To Write The Top Section

Direct Answer: The top section of a biotech manufacturing service page should answer the page topic immediately, reinforce the primary service keyword, and help both buyers and AI systems understand the page before they scroll.

Use A Strong H1

The H1 should usually reflect the main service keyword directly. For example, use Biotech Contract Manufacturing, Sterile Packaging Solutions, Validation Support Services, or Cleanroom Assembly Manufacturing rather than a broad slogan.

Write A Clear Summary Snippet

The summary should explain the service in 40 to 60 words. It should be extractable, direct, and practical. For example, a Validation Support Services page could explain that the service helps biotech companies document, prepare, organize, and support validation-related work with clearer process alignment and reduced operational uncertainty.

Use Supporting Intro Paragraphs

The intro should expand the context. It should explain what the service does, who usually needs it, and why the page matters. However, it should not wander into unrelated brand messaging. The top of the page is for clarity first, and then for helpful expansion.

Conversion Architecture For Biotech Manufacturing

Direct Answer: Conversion Architecture For Biotech Manufacturing service pages should match long-cycle buyer behavior by offering several relevant next steps instead of forcing every visitor into one hard-sales form.

Use Multiple CTA Paths

A strong page may offer options such as Request A Consultation, Review Your Application Fit, Discuss Your Packaging Needs, Ask A Technical Specialist, Request A Quote, or Explore Manufacturing Support. These options respect the fact that not every visitor has the same readiness level.

Place CTAs Where They Make Sense

Do not place one aggressive CTA at the top and hope that solves conversion. Instead, position logical CTAs after clarity, after fit, after proof, and near the bottom of the page. Consequently, the page supports different decision stages without feeling pushy.

Keep Conversion Language Practical

Biotech buyers usually respond better to practical language than to exaggerated urgency. Therefore, phrases like review your production needs, discuss application fit, or talk through your manufacturing requirements often work better than vague hype-driven CTA language.

SEO, GEO, And AI Rules For Service Pages

Direct Answer: Biotech manufacturing service pages need strong keyword targeting, clean subheading structure, direct-answer sections, clear terminology, and schema-supported clarity so search engines and AI systems can understand the page quickly.

Use The Service Keyphrase Early

Place the service keyphrase in the title, meta description, H1, summary, first paragraph, and selected H2 or H3 subheadings where it fits naturally. This reinforces the page topic immediately and clearly.

Keep Headings Clear

Use descriptive H2 and H3 headings instead of clever labels. For example, What Sterile Packaging Solutions Solve is clearer than Better Manufacturing Starts Here. Clear headings reduce ambiguity for both buyers and AI systems.

Use Direct-Answer Blocks

Open each major section with a direct-answer paragraph. This helps extraction, readability, and AI citation readiness while also improving user scanning behavior.

Break Long Sections With Subheadings

Do not let major sections run too long without structure. When a section pushes past about 300 words, add a useful subheading. As a result, the page becomes easier to scan, easier to understand, and easier to interpret.
